Banco Popular does more than just serve Puerto Rico, where it's headquartered. The bank has branches throughout the United States in New Jersey, New York, California, Florida, Texas and Illinois. Personal banking products include checking, savings and mortgage and home-equity products. Popular also offers investment and wealth management. The company is affiliated with E-Loan, an online banking and mortgage provider.

Overdraft fees are ridiculous. I had to pay $150 in overdraft fees because they could not warn me or freeze my debit card, instead letting me run up a considerable amount of fees into the hundreds. I am closing my account with this institution and I hope that anyone who considers doing business with Banco Popular steers clear from them.

This is an awful Bank. Don't you dare to go overdraft. In less than a year we had paid over 300. dollars in NSF fees. Due to the fact that lets say you overdraft over 15 cents and they collect 30 ov fee , plus $5 every day fee and if you don't pay be a few days they will charge you another 30 dollars plus 5 per day. We were recently overdraft by 30. did not realized it until by the end of the month and they had incurred $130 for an over 30 overdraft. Do not bank with this bank. I will close my accounts with them.

Worst customer service on the planet. It usually takes 2 or 3 tries (on hold for 30-40 minutes) before someone will answer without the call being dropped. Also, once you get someone on the line they transfer you and you have to wait another 20-30 minutes and all the info is in Spanish (even though you pressed 1 for English) so you don't know what the different menus are! I would never open another account because the way they treat customers is terrible. Just to order checks you have to mail in a form (snail mail) and then call 3 times to check and see if they got it. I've wasted 6 hours of my life with this company just to get checks in the mail to me. Terrible company.
